Abstract (EN)

This thesis consists of six chapters. In the first chapter, the motivation of the problems and their background are presented. In the second chapter, we give some notions and definitions which will be used in the others chapters. In the third chapter, we define the invariant submanifold of almost α-cosymplectic f-manifolds. We have investigate the curvature properties and have given some results for invariant submanifolds of almost α-cosymplectic f-manifolds. We also present some theorems for semi-invariant submanifolds of almost α-cosymplectic f-manifolds and investigate the integrability of the distributions. In the fourth chapter, we define almost α-cosymplectic f-manifolds endowed with a quarter-symmetric metric connection. We have calculated the curvature, the Ricci tensor and the scaler curvature with respect to a quarter-symmetric metric connection. Moreover, we show that there is not generalized recurrent, ϕ-recurrent α-cosymplectic f-manifolds. In the fifth chapter, we introduce almost α-cosymplectic f-manifolds endowed with a semi-symmetric non-metric connection. We also investigate the Riemann curvature tensor field, the ricci tensor field and give some theorems for almost α-cosymplectic f-manifolds. In the sixth chapter, we define semi-invariant submanifold of almost α-cosymplectic f-manifolds endowed with a semi-symmetric non-metric connection and obtain some results. Moreover, we obtain the integrability of distributions and their results.
